Colt New Police from 1905 chambered for .32 Colt long. Needed to come up with some heeled bullets, so I made a die that would swage heels on .32 caliber hollow based wadcutters. Drop it on some parallels in a Kurt milling machine vice, stick in a wadcutter,..*OOMPH!*,..there ya got it,..a heeled hollow base wadcutter. Ready fer bid'niz.
